script_name(english:"NVIDIA CUDA Toolkit < 13.1 Multiple Vulnerabilities");
script_set_attribute(attribute:"synopsis", value:
"The remote host is missing one or more security updates.");
script_set_attribute(attribute:"description", value:
"The version of NVIDIA CUDA Toolkit installed on the remote host is prior to 13.1. It is, therefore, affected by
multiple vulnerabilities, including the following:
- NVIDIA Nsight Systems contains a vulnerability in the gfx_hotspot recipe, where an attacker could cause
an OS command injection by supplying a malicious string to the process_nsys_rep_cli.py script if the
script is invoked manually. A successful exploit of this vulnerability might lead to code execution,
escalation of privileges, data tampering, denial of service, and information disclosure. (CVE-2025-33228)
- NVIDIA Nsight Visual Studio for Windows contains a vulnerability in Nsight Monitor where an attacker can
execute arbitrary code with the same privileges as the NVIDIA Nsight Visual Studio Edition Monitor
application. A successful exploit of this vulnerability may lead to escalation of privileges, code
execution, data tampering, denial of service, and information disclosure. (CVE-2025-33229)
- NVIDIA Nsight Systems for Linux contains a vulnerability in the .run installer, where an attacker could
cause an OS command injection by supplying a malicious string to the installation path. A successful
exploit of this vulnerability might lead to escalation of privileges, code execution, data tampering,
denial of service, and information disclosure. (CVE-2025-33230)
Note that Nessus has not tested for these issues but has instead relied only on the application's self-reported version
number.");
script_set_attribute(attribute:"see_also", value:"https://nvidia.custhelp.com/app/answers/detail/a_id/5755");
script_set_attribute(attribute:"solution", value:
"Upgrade to NVIDIA CUDA Toolkit version 13.1 or later.");
